If the government shutdown continues into the season, it is very likely nobody will be able to access it.
Don't get mad at the refuge personnel, it is beyond their control. Law enforcement will still be around and enforcing regulations and closed areas.
However, places like WRP land owned by fws up north, and unmanned property are open in other states. Also, states have the option to open federal government places such as Parks if they pay for the costs to operate them.
